What Are the Potential End Results of My Situation?



Understanding the prospective outcomes of a criminal case is crucial for anybody going across the lawful system. An offender ought to ask about the feasible results that could occur from their situation. End results may vary from pardon, where the accused is located not guilty, to various kinds of conviction, which can include lower fees or considerable penalties. Furthermore, the offender might face plea deals, where they consent to beg guilty in exchange for a more lenient sentence.It is essential for the accused to understand the implications of each end result, including the influence on their personal and expert life. The attorney needs to likewise describe the likelihood of each scenario based on the case's distinct conditions. By talking about potential results with their lawyer, the accused can make enlightened decisions throughout the test procedure and much better prepare themselves wherefore exists ahead.


What Are the Feasible Defenses Available for My Fees?



When encountering criminal costs, an offender may ask yourself which defenses can be appropriate to their situation. Comprehending the variety of prospective defenses is crucial for a complete lawful approach. Typical defenses consist of alibi, where the offender proves they were in other places during the criminal offense; protection, which validates the usage of force to secure oneself; and lack of intent, where the defendant shows they did not have the requisite frame of mind to commit the criminal activity. Various other defenses may consist of entrapment, saying that law enforcement induced criminal behavior, or insanity, claiming the defendant was not in a sound state of mind. Additionally, going against civil liberties during arrest or investigation can additionally offer as a defense. By talking about these choices with a criminal defense attorney, an offender can analyze which defenses may be feasible based upon the specifics of their case and the proof available.

What Are Your Fees and Repayment Framework?



What should customers anticipate concerning charges and settlement structures from their criminal protection attorney? Understanding the monetary aspects of lawful depiction is essential. Lawyers typically offer numerous fee plans, consisting of per hour rates, level charges for certain services, or contingency fees, though the latter is less common in criminal cases. Clients need to ask about the complete approximated prices, including possible added costs like court charges or skilled witness charges.Transparency is essential; customers need to comprehend what is included in the fee and whether a retainer is required upfront. It is also vital to review repayment strategies if the total price is too high. Some attorneys may provide versatile choices to suit customers' financial situations. Clients should really feel encouraged to ask comprehensive inquiries regarding any kind of unclear charges or payment terms, guaranteeing they have a clear understanding of their economic obligations prior to waging representation.
